Magnetization and Critical Current of a Weakly Anisotropic HTSC with Columnar Pinning Centers

摘要
The effect of columnar pinning centers on the current–voltage characteristic, the critical current, and the shape of the magnetization curve has been studied by the Monte Carlo method within a three-dimensional model of a layered high-temperature superconductor. It has been shown that the presence of a weak intrinsic pinning does not qualitatively change the calculation results. It has been shown that a periodic lattice of pinning centers leads to an avalanche-like penetration of vortices at a certain threshold field and the existence of vortex-free regions at a lower field. This difference has been demonstrated on the magnetization curves. These effects have not been observed for a quasi-periodic lattice of pinning centers.
